Gatorade Slushie

A Gatorade slushie is a frozen beverage made by blending sports drinks with ice to create a crunchy, icy texture. The main ingredients are flavored electrolyte-packed drinks and ice, resulting in a vibrant, semi-frozen treat with a tangy, refreshing profile. The final appearance is a colorful, slushy consistency ideal for cooling down on hot days.

Ingredients
  

  • 2 cups Gatorade or sports drink Choose your favorite flavor
  • 1 cup ice cubes Add more for a thicker slushie

Equipment

  • Blender
  • Measuring cup

Method
 

  1. Pour the sports drink into the blender, filling it about halfway.
  2. Add the ice cubes to the blender over the liquid.
  3. Secure the lid and blend on high until the mixture is smooth and well combined, with a slushy, icy texture visible around the blades.
  4. Pause briefly to check the consistency—if it's too runny, add more ice and blend again until thick and crunchy.
  5. Once the desired slushy texture is achieved, turn off the blender and pour the beverage into chilled glasses.
  6. Serve immediately with a straw or spoon for a refreshing, icy treat.
